Putting
Your Saw Together
Your radial arm saw is easy to put together,
however
it will take time. Ask a friend to
help, and follow
these assembly
instructions.
It is important
for your safety,
and for the
quality
of your cuts, that the saw be put
together
with care.
WARNING:
Plugging the saw in
during assembly can result in electrical
shock or your fingers, hand, or arm be-
ing cut off from blade contact. Do not
plug in the saw at any time during as-
sembly. The saw should only be
plugged in when it is to be used.
Unpacking/Set
up
1. As you unpack,
try to keep the contents
of
each of the smaller bags together
and separate
from the others. This will help you identify
and
locate the parts you need during assembly.
